Output 09592de8f3a25ea0ef0dd06905776b01c8abd32037d6f8c3fda1db6c60a5c77a:3

value
25000000
script pubkey
OP_0 OP_PUSHBYTES_20 b3186dafd95ade14d9b8166954441e76e07f425a
address
bc1qkvvxmt7ett0pfkdcze54g3q7wms87sj6enn87x
transaction
09592de8f3a25ea0ef0dd06905776b01c8abd32037d6f8c3fda1db6c60a5c77a
confirmations
184430
spent
true